On December 10th, 2025, we received another EB-2 NIW (National Interest Waiver) approval for a Scientist in the Field of Chemistry (Approval Notice).
General Field: Chemistry
Position at the Time of Case Filing: Scientist
Country of Origin: India
State of Residence at the Time of Filing: Pennsylvania
Approval Notice Date: December 10th, 2025
Processing Time: 2 months, 11 days (Premium Processing Upgrade Requested)

Strengthening America’s Environmental and Public Health Priorities
Holding a Ph.D. in Chemistry, the client is an accomplished researcher whose work centers on designing and formulating sustainable barrier coatings and polymer-based materials. The proposed endeavor focuses on developing environmentally responsible coating technologies and packaging materials capable of replacing single-use plastics commonly used in food, pharmaceutical, and electronic applications. This line of research directly supports U.S. efforts to reduce plastic pollution, improve public health, and advance safer, biodegradable alternatives critical to national sustainability goals.
The client is currently employed as a scientist in a role that aligns closely with this endeavor, contributing to the development of next-generation polymer-based materials for high-performance and eco-friendly packaging solutions.
Demonstrating Scientific Excellence and Influence
The client’s research productivity and scholarly influence are reflected in a growing body of peer-reviewed work, including five first-authored journal articles and one abstract. These publications have already received 26 citations, demonstrating meaningful impact within the chemistry, materials science, and sustainable packaging communities.
In addition, the client has completed at least 27 reviews for respected journals and federal grant programs, a clear indicator of recognized expertise in the field. Only highly trusted specialists are invited to evaluate the work of other researchers or assess the merits of federally funded scientific proposals.
The petition further demonstrated the client’s significance through evidence of major funding sources that have supported this line of research, including the National Institutes of Health (NIH), the National Cancer Institute (NCI), and the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A). Such funding is reserved for work with clear societal value, and its inclusion underscores national recognition of the client’s contribution to sustainable materials innovation.
Expert Endorsements Supporting National Impact
The NIW petition was strengthened by persuasive letters of recommendation from established experts in the field. These letters detailed the novelty of the client’s research, its growing influence among independent researchers, and the importance of continuing this work in the United States.
